Union Creek principal spotlights student awards, attendance gains and test-score improvements

Coffee County School Board · April 24, 2026
AI-Generated Content: All content on this page was generated by AI to highlight key points from the meeting. For complete details and context, we recommend watching the full video. so we can fix them.

Summary

Allen Chancey, principal of Union Creek, reported student recognitions and community events and presented attendance and STAR assessment gains; he said students raised $7,000 for Jump Rope for Heart and the school earned national recognition as a Capturing Kids' Hearts showcase school.

Union Creek Principal Allen Chancey gave a school update highlighting student awards, extra‑curricular events and measurable assessment gains.

Chancey said students raised $7,000 for the Jump Rope for Heart fundraiser, singling out Alona Lewis for donating $1,000. He also noted Brandy Batten was a county‑level winner in a recent competition and that the school received Georgia Literacy Leaders recognition for third‑ and fifth‑grade literacy growth.
